CBD or cannabidiol is a naturally derived compound from cannabis plants. It’s one of over a hundred compounds in a class called cannabinoids.
These cannabinoids look very similar to neurotransmitters in mammal bodies called endogenous cannabinoids in a system called the endocannabinoid system (ECS). The ECS is responsible for maintaining homeostasis (balance) in a wide variety of functions, including the sleep-wake cycle, stress, metabolism, mood, and the immune system.
CBD is not to be confused with its more notorious cousin, THC (tetrahydrocannabinol). Unlike THC, CBD does not produce intoxicating effects, which makes it a more reliable compound in terms of supporting one’s health with daily use.
Hemp crops have high concentrations of CBD, and that’s where legal CBD comes from. Thanks to the US Farm Bill in 2018, hemp crops that contain up to 0.3% THC were legalized, while marijuana plants (anything with over 0.3% THC) remain federally illegal.
CBD is incredibly versatile and can be found in anything from capsules, sublingual oils, topical treatments, and even pet treats and food.
